[ARCHIVED] Iowa Department of Transportation I-35 Public Meeting

You are invited to attend a Public Information Meeting on December 16, 2014, between 5 and 6:30 p.m., at the Crossroad Baptist Church, 57011 U.S. 30, Ames, IA, to discuss the proposed replacement of the bridges on I-35 over the Skunk River, 2.6 miles south of U.S. 30, in Story County. The proposed project would include widening approximately 1.5 miles of I-35 to six lanes and replacing the bridge over I-35 at Story County Road E-57. Iowa Department of Transportation staff will be available during this time to answer questions regarding the proposal.

Story County Road E-57 would be closed to through traffic during construction. A detour route will be established by the county closer to the time of construction.

No formal presentation will be made; however, details of the proposed improvement will be discussed at the meeting.
